Border Security Force jawan killed, civilians hurt in Pakistan shelling

A BSF jawan was killed and 10 civilians were injured as Pakistani Rangers stepped up ceasefire violations along the International Border (IB) and the Line of Control (LoC) in the Jammu region on Thursday. The BSF said it killed one Pakistani Ranger in “retaliatory fire.”

BSF head constable Jitender Kumar, who suffered grievous injuries in Pakistani shelling in R.S. Pora Sector’s Abdullian area, died on Thursday morning. There had been an intermittent exchange of fire since Wednesday night.

The ten civilians were injured as the 192-km long IB witnessed heavy exchange of fire.

A BSF official said the BSF troops in R.S Pora and Arnia Sectors killed a Pakistani Ranger and injured another between 12.30 p.m. and 1.15 p.m.

A soldier was killed and another injured as the Army foiled an infiltration bid in Kupwara district on Thursday.

A Srinagar-based spokesman said the infiltration attempt was made in the Tangdhar Sector on the Line of Control.
